Biohazards can result from many different situations, including deaths, medical emergencies, hoarding, animal infestations, and illicit drug use. Biohazard scenes can generate significant amounts of potentially infectious waste including

  • Blood and bodily fluids.

  • Vomit and feces.

  • Animal waste and remains.

  • Spoiled and rotting food.

  • Needles, IV catheters, and other ‘sharps.’

  • Viral and bacterial pathogens.

Proper removal, disposal, and cleanup of biohazards is essential to protect the health and safety of occupants. Pathogens such as HIV, hepatitis B and C, and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A) can survive on contaminated surfaces for days or weeks. Moreover, contamination may extend beyond what is readily visible. For example, blood and bodily fluids can be transferred to clothing, bedding, or upholstery, or seep through flooring materials and into subfloors.

Our Process

To ensure that your home or business can be safely reoccupied following a biohazard event, we follow a detailed mitigation process.

We start by assessing the scene to identify hazards and develop an action plan, and we isolate the work area from other parts of the home or business to prevent cross-contamination. We then systematically remove all contaminated items, salvaging those that we can clean and disinfect, with strict adherence to OSHA guidelines.

Once all visible traces of biological materials are removed, we perform a thorough decontamination of affected surfaces using hospital-grade cleaners and disinfectants. Where necessary, final steps may include measures such as odor removal or sealing of porous surfaces such as wood framing and subfloors. 

Throughout the mitigation process, we continuously test for the presence of biological materials to make sure nothing is missed.
